Don't do it OP, the value has to come from somewhere, the APY being given to you isn't coming anywhere, it's being printed. All this does is lower the price for anyone holding.

The ways to make money from this is if you're earlier (like very early, as in a developer), or if you get lucky by being further up on the ponzi scheme than others coming in. Otherwise, you'll just be dumped on by people who came earlier than you did.
Additionally, they usually require you to stake the shit coin + something actually with value, so people can force you to buy their fat stacks of shitcoin, and leave you with something valueless. This leaves you vulnerable to rugpulls from shady shit coins.

It's a bit fucked desu because of the retards, otherwise it'd be an easy to short some of these, however occasionally they will spike in price because people see 1000% APY and chimp out.

Find something with better fundamental value and hold onto it. You can get lucky with those too.
